  This class is an interface to the Hbook objects in Hbook files
  Any Hbook object (1-D, 2-D, Profile, RWN or CWN can be read
  NB: a THbookFile can only be used in READ mode
      Use the utility in $ROOTSYS/bin/h2root to convert Hbook to Root
 Example of use:
  gSystem->Load("libHbook");
  THbookFile f("myfile.hbook");
  f.ls();
  TH1F *h1 = (TH1F*)f.Get(1);  //import histogram ID=1 in h1
  h1->Fit("gaus");
  THbookTree *T = (THbookTree*)f.Get(111); //import ntuple header
  T->Print();  //show the Hbook ntuple variables
  T->Draw("x","y<0"); // as in normal TTree::Draw
  THbookFile can be browsed via TBrowser.

void InitLeaves(Int_t id, Int_t var, TTreeFormula *formula)
 This function is called from the first entry in TTreePlayer::InitLoop
 It analyzes the list of variables involved in the current query
 and pre-process the internal Hbook tables to speed-up the search
 at the next entries.

TFile* Convert2root(const char *rootname, Int_t /*lrecl*/,
                                Option_t *option)
 Convert this Hbook file to a Root file with name rootname.
 if rootname="', rootname = hbook file name with .root instead of .hbook
 By default, the Root file is connected and returned
 option:
       - "NO" do not connect the Root file
       - "C"  do not compress file (default is to compress)
       - "L"  do not convert names to lower case (default is to convert)
